Abuja goes agog as creme de la creme storm Bannex, Wuse 2, Maitama for Okiro’s 77th birthday bash
The streets of Abuja went agog on Friday, July 24th, 2026, as the high and mighty, business moguls, politicians, media gurus, and top echelons of the Nigeria Police Force converged in their numbers to celebrate a living legend at 77, Chief Sir Mike Mbama Okiro.
The occasion was the 77th birthday bash of the former Inspector General of Police and former Chairman of the Police Service Commission, held at his Abuja residence. What followed was a colorful display of love, respect, and admiration that brought traffic to a near standstill across Banex, Wuse 2 and Maitama axis.

77 Years of Humility, Service and Impact
Chief Sir Mike Mbama Okiro is loved across divides for three things: humility, simplicity, and a kind heart.
At 77, he remains a reference point for leadership with character. During his tenure as IGP and later as PSC Chairman, he was credited with reforms that professionalized the Force and prioritized officer welfare.
But beyond office, it is his philanthropy that has endeared him to many. Over the years, he has quietly helped thousands from scholarships for indigent students to empowerment for widows and support for police families.
